I found some of your answeres in the links below. I am not a LEO yet, but my brother inlaw is a deputy for Yavapai County and they go through same academy as Flagstaff (NARTA). As for sworn it looks like 114 and 57 civilian. Flagstaff is not huge city but it has pop. of about 64,000. Trees, trees and more trees. Ride-alongs should be as simple as a phone rerquest and filling out waivers (or at least that is how it is with my brother, a Sargent in Glendale). Not sure what you want to know about firearm policy, but in AZ as an officer you can carry everywhere, no questions asked. Also you get to carry a back-up if you so choose. Just spoke to one of the Sgt's there. He talked to me briefly about the department and the such. Department policy on firearms is GLOCK. They issue the 22. You can carry your own G27 (compact .40) as backup, and you can purchase your own M4, but it can't be overly modified.
Not too bad, though I was hoping that I could pick and choose my primary carry. I love my HS2000 and my Sigs. Oh well, at least its not a big heavy S&W5906 or something along those lines. He also talked about how the dept. is fairly tight nit and family oriented, which is exactly what Im looking for. I grew up in a small department (70 or so sworn) so I like it when you know everyone else who works there with you. Application inbound.
